Human Rights Watch says ‘1000’s’ killed in assaults final 12 months focusing on Masalit tribe and different non-Arab teams.
Sudan’s paramilitary Speedy Assist Forces (RSF) and allied militias killed “no less than 1000’s of individuals” in West Darfur state, a world rights group has stated, in what it referred to as obvious “crimes in opposition to humanity” and “genocide”.
In a report printed on Thursday, Human Rights Watch (HRW) stated that RSF assaults on the Masalit tribe and different non-Arab teams between April and November 2023 had been among the worst atrocities within the ongoing civil war which began that April.
The assaults in el-Geneina, the capital of West Darfur, noticed total neighbourhoods housing primarily displaced Masalit communities looted, burned, shelled and razed to the bottom.
The marketing campaign that amounted to “ethnic cleaning” left a whole bunch of 1000’s of individuals as refugees, HRW stated in its 186-page report.
The violence, which included mass torture, rape and looting, peaked in mid-June – when 1000’s of individuals had been killed inside days – and surged once more in November, it stated.

Between June 2023 and April 2024, HRW interviewed greater than 220 individuals in Chad, Uganda, Kenya and South Sudan. It stated its researchers additionally reviewed and analysed greater than 120 images and movies of the occasions, satellite tv for pc imagery and paperwork shared by humanitarian teams to corroborate accounts of abuses.
Sudan descended into chaos in April 2023, when long-simmering tensions between the Sudanese Armed Forces (SAF), led by Normal Abdel Fattah Burhan, and the RSF, lef by Mohamed “Hemedti” Dagalo, broke out into avenue battles within the capital, Khartoum.
El-Geneina, the place Masalits make up greater than half of the inhabitants, has seen among the fiercest combating outdoors Khartoum since.
The UN’s World Meals Programme final week warned of the deteriorating state of affairs in Darfur, the place support has been reduce off as advancing RSF forces try and take management of el-Fasher, the place an estimated 500,000 displaced civilians are sheltering.
“Because the UN Safety Council and governments get up to the looming catastrophe in El Fasher, the large-scale atrocities dedicated in El Geneina must be seen as a reminder of the atrocities that would come within the absence of concerted motion,” stated HRW government director Tirana Hassan.
Greater than half 1,000,000 refugees from West Darfur have fled to Chad since April 2023. As of late October 2023, 75 p.c had been from el-Geneina, HRW stated, because it referred to as for the UN and the African Union to sanction these accountable and impose an arms embargo on the RSF.
